Medical abortion refers to a non-surgical method of terminating a pregnancy using pharmaceutical drugs. This process typically involves the administration of two different medications: mifepristone and misoprostol. Mifepristone, also known as RU-486, is taken first and works by blocking the hormone progesterone, which is essential for maintaining the pregnancy. Without progesterone, the uterine lining begins to break down, and the embryo can no longer remain implanted. This is usually followed by the second medication, misoprostol, which is taken either 24 to 48 hours later. Misoprostol induces contractions in the uterus, leading to the expulsion of the pregnancy tissue. Medical abortion can be administered during the early stages of pregnancy, typically up to 10 weeks gestation, although guidelines may vary by region. The process generally requires a consultation with a healthcare provider who will evaluate the individual's health, confirm the diagnosis of pregnancy, and ensure that the method is appropriate for the patient's circumstances. One of the significant advantages of a medical abortion is that it can often be done at home, providing privacy and comfort for the patient, though some women prefer to have access to a healthcare facility. The experience varies from person to person; some may experience mild to moderate cramping and bleeding, while others may find it more intense. It is important for individuals to be aware of potential side effects and complications, such as excessive bleeding, infection, or incomplete abortion, which may necessitate further medical treatment. Follow-up with a healthcare provider is essential to ensure that the abortion is complete and to address any complications. Although medical abortion is generally safe and effective, it is essential to consider the legal and ethical aspects surrounding it in different regions, as laws vary significantly. Access to medical abortion can be restricted in some areas, impacting individuals' choices and the availability of necessary healthcare services. Education and counseling are crucial components of the process, helping patients understand what to expect, both physically and emotionally. Support from healthcare professionals, family, or friends can also play a vital role in helping individuals cope with the experience, ensuring they feel supported throughout the process. Overall, medical abortion offers a safe alternative to surgical abortion for many women, but it is essential that it is approached with proper guidance, care, and consideration for the individual's health and emotional well-being.
